## Session Handling — Farepilot Experiments

Plugin requests to the Farepilot pricing-experiment API must carry a session bound to a single experiment cohort. Sessions expire after 30 minutes idle; renew via `POST /session/refresh`. Cross-cohort reuse returns 409. Plugins never mint sessions themselves — they exchange a bearer credential at `/session/init`. The sandbox credential for that exchange appears below.

session JWT of yawep-yawep = eyJhbGciOiJIUzI1NiIsInR5cCI6IkpXVCJ9.eyJzdWIiOiI3pWF3_In0.aXYsHiog

Ticket: Staging env misconfigured for Siftgate bloom filter

The bloom layer in front of the Pellet KV store is rejecting all lookups in staging because the env file was copied from the dev template without credentials. False-positive tuning values are fine; only the auth line is missing. To unblock the weekly demo, the Pellet admission secret must be set on the following line.

env line for yaguf-fajop: LEDGER_TOKEN13=fb08984397349

# Handover: LB Health Checks

Taking over the Fennick gateway health checks. Current state: the deep check hits the database and times out under load, causing the balancer to drain healthy nodes. Interim fix: shallow check on /ping, deep check moved to a cron alert. Don't revert without testing under the Drybrook load profile. Release manager: hold any gateway deploys until the new thresholds are verified by the owner.

named custodian: Brivan Eliath Quenox Frador